About the Role:
Precious Cargo Preschool & Childcare in Salem, OR is looking for a passionate and experienced Childcare Center Director to lead our dedicated team of early childhood educators. This is an exciting opportunity to make a meaningful impact on the lives of children and families in our community while guiding a nurturing, high-quality childcare program.



Responsibilities:
  • Oversee daily operations of the childcare center, ensuring a safe, compliant, and enriching environment
  • Recruit, hire, train, and supervise childcare staff and teaching assistants
  • Develop and implement age-appropriate early childhood education curricula and programs
  • Maintain compliance with Oregon childcare licensing regulations and state/local health and safety standards
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with enrolled families through open communication and family engagement initiatives
  • Manage center budget, enrollment, and administrative functions including recordkeeping and reporting
  • Conduct staff performance evaluations and facilitate ongoing professional development
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for licensing agencies, community partners, and prospective families
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ree in Early Childhood Education, Child Development, or a related field preferred
  • Minimum step 8 in the Oregon Registry Online
  • Minimum 2–3 years of experience in childcare center management or a director-level role
  • Knowledge of Oregon childcare licensing requirements and NAEYC accreditation standards
  • Current CPR and First Aid certification (or ability to obtain upon hire)
  •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ills
  • Experience with childcare management software and administrative recordkeeping
  • Genuine passion for early childhood education and child development
  • Ability to pass a background check in accordance with Oregon childcare regulations
